In the early 1970’s, part of the land on which the course now stands was donated to the Council for the purpose of constructing a Public Golf Course for the benefit of the residents of the Mornington Peninsula Shire.In 1977, the then Shire President Cr. Marcia Sly, and deputy President Cr. D Gordon, officially opened the Golf Course. In 1980, the then Shire President, Cr. R. Cooper, officially opened the pavilion which became affectionately known as “The Tin Shed” and encouraged those in attendance to form a Golf Club.<\/p>\t\n\t\t\t\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\tread more\n\t\t<\/a>\n\t\t\t\t\"All\n\t
